I . Song and Prayer
II . Body of family home evening:
1. Read: "The Proclamation on the Family was issued five years ago by the First Presidency and
the Quorum of the Twelve. The Proclamation on the Family, teaches us of our
responsibility to our children, and the children's responsibility to their parents, and the
parents' responsibility to each other. That marvelous document brings together the scriptural
direction that we have received that has guided the lives of God's children from
the time of Adam and Eve and will continue to guide us until the final winding-up scene.

3. Read: "Ruby and I were up in Idaho for a short visit, and we met some people from Mountain Home,
Idaho, the Goodrich family. Sister Goodrich had come to see us and had brought her
daughter Chelsea with her. In part of the conversation that we were having, Sister
Goodrich said Chelsea had memorized the proclamation on the family.
To Chelsea, who is now 15 years old, I said, "Chelsea, is that right?"
She said, "Yes."
I said, "How long did it take you to do that?"
She said, "When we were young my mother started a program in our house to help us
memorize. We would memorize scripture passages and sacrament meeting songs and other
types of things that would be helpful to us. So we learned how to memorize, and it
became easier for us."
I said, "Then you can give it all?"
She said, "Yes, I can give it all."
I said, "You learned that when you were 12 years old; you're now 15. Pretty soon you'll start
dating. Tell me about it. What has it done for you?"
Chelsea said, "As I think of the statements in that proclamation, and as I understand more of
our responsibility as a family and our responsibility for the way we live and the way we
should conduct our lives, the proclamation becomes a new guideline for me. As I
associate with other people and when I start dating, I can think of those phrases and those
sentences in the proclamation on the family. It will give me a yardstick which will help guide me.
It will give me the strength that I need."
4. Make a paper chain out of colored paper. Put a family name on each link. Make sure all the links are stapled and glued. Put this somewhere in the home that all of your family can see it.
(use strips of colored paper two inches thick, put the names of all family members on with a permanent marker. glue and staple the ends inside of each other to make a chain.)

Read: "So I would say to all of you here this morning, I hope you could develop a strong feeling in your own families--and with you personally--about not wanting to become a weak link in the chain of your family and of your ancestors. I encourage you also to be a strong link for your posterity. Do not be the weak link. Wouldn't that be a terrible thing to do? To think of that long chain and of all that work that needs to be done in the saving of souls and of the precious work that needs to be done, wouldn't it be sad if you were the one who was the weak link that caused your descendants not to be able to be part of that strong linkage?
I leave you my love and my witness and the knowledge that I have that this work is true. I know that God lives. I know that He loves us. He loves us just as we love our children and our posterity. We now have 65 great-grandchildren, and of course we'll have more on their way. We love them all, and we hope that the chains and the links in our family will be strong, and that our children will be blessed. We're proud of all of them and pray that they will grow up with the strong knowledge and the feeling that I have regarding God, that He lives, that He's our Father, and that all of this work is under His direction, that of His Son, who is our Savior, Jesus the Christ. This is the Church of Jesus Christ restored to the earth in these latter days. I know it is true.
I know that we have a living prophet upon the earth today, and you can see the marvelous things that are happening in the Church now with 100 operating temples. Some of you here will live to see the day when there are 200 operating temples and then 300 operating temples, and whatever the number might eventually become. Well, we're living at this time and this day and age when marvelous things are happening. When we talk about a living prophet who receives revelations from on high in directing this work, I testify to you that those of us who work and associate with him can testify to you that he is God's prophet here upon the earth, leading us in doing what is right and what is proper.
May your links be strong. May you personally find the great joy and the happiness that can be ours through living the principles of the gospel. I leave you my love and this witness that the Church is true, in the name of Jesus Christ, amen."
6. Every night for the next month begin memorizing the Proclamation on the Family. continue until all the members of your family have memorized it.
